Abstract [eng] In conclusion of the master thesis investigated the possibility of secondary raw materials. An overview of global trends with the use of secondary raw materials. These days, the construction sector generated relatively large amounts of construction waste. In order to prevent the ecological and economic disaster, it is suggested that there is possibility that waste construction materials can be recycled and reused. Scientists from various countries have examined trends in the use of re-cycled materials in the products and constructions. In this thesis it was studied that it is possible to use crushed concrete rubble instead of do-lomite rubble in the construction of temporary carriageway roads, welfare, and the basics under the structure. The resulting value of deformation modules E meets the requirements of the Republic of Lithuania. Eco - economic approach to the use of secondary materials is useful for incoming me-chanical and physical properties. In economic terms, it is cheaper to install foundations with crushed concrete rubble compared with respect to dolomite rubble.
